Project Details
Following a train driver accident in the south of England, which caused a train driver to suffer a broken leg whilst climbing down from his cab onto a high ballast shoulder; 4 no. new driver walkways on the recently implemented Leamington Corridor resignalling scheme were deemed unfit for purpose in case of a repeat incident.
Network Rail commissioned APB Group Ltd to survey, design & build, 4 new walkways to lift the existing walkways at 4 signals and therefore allow final close out of the project.
APB Group Ltd provided Form A & B designs in a record period of just 3 weeks allowing 7 pre-booked possessions to be utilised to complete the installation works.

Works Scope
The works included:
· Provide all H & S documentation.
· Carry out topographical surveys at the 4 sites.
· Provide Form A & Form B designs.
· Fabricate and galvanise 4 bespoke structures.
· Install 10 no. Grundomat steel cased piles at 3 of the locations (30 piles total).
· Assemble the walkways on site on top of the piled foundations.
